LensCrafters is an international retailer of prescription eyewear and sunglasses, founded in 1983 by E. Dean Butler. It is owned by EssilorLuxottica, the largest eyewear company in the world, and operates 1,158 stores in North America, China, Hong Kong and India.
Luxottica is a subsidiary of EssilorLuxottica, the world's largest eyewear company, formed by the merger of Luxottica and Essilor in 2018. Luxottica designs, manufactures, distributes, and retails eyewear brands such as Ray-Ban, Persol, Oakley, and many luxury and designer labels.
Pearle Vision is a subsidiary of EssilorLuxottica, one of the largest franchised optical retailers in North America. It was founded in 1961 by Stanley Pearle, an optometrist in Georgia, and has expanded to over 1,000 locations worldwide.

EssilorLuxottica is an Italian-French company that produces and sells ophthalmic lenses, optical equipment, prescription glasses and sunglasses. It was created in 2018 from the merger of Essilor and Luxottica, two leading players in the eyewear industry, and is listed on the Euronext Paris stock exchange.
Leonardo Del Vecchio (1935-2022) was an Italian billionaire businessman, the founder and chairman of Luxottica, the world's largest producer and retailer of glasses and frames. He acquired many brands such as Ray-Ban, Oakley and Sunglass Hut, and owned stakes in Mediobanca, EssilorLuxottica and other companies.
